- 博客(18)
- 收藏
- 关注
原创 数据库基础
理论上是完全可行性的,有多个failgroup提供高冗余,在该节点假如有一个failgroup发生故障也不会有其他的影响,但考虑到只有一个存储节点,安全性能几乎没有,如果存储节点宕掉了,后果不堪设想。而关闭数据库实例只会关闭特定的数据库实例,但数据库的其他实例仍然可以继续运行。Oracle数据库实例是处理用户 请求的数据库进程和内存结构,而Oracle ASM实例是管理ASM磁盘组的进程。6.ora.asmnet1.asmnetwork(...):是ASM实例的网络资源,用于管理ASM实例的网络连接。
2024-03-20 17:53:51
907
1
原创 数据库硬件基础
对于服务而言,硬盘的速度和可靠性直接影响到数据的读写性能和数据的安全性。此外,对于服务的可靠性和容错性而言,硬盘的冗余性(如 RAID)和备份策略非常重要。(1)千兆与万兆网卡之间由于单位换算的原因实际传输速率是之前的1/8,因为Byte和bit的区别,1byte=8bit。RAID 1 是一种镜像备份,需要至少两块盘,数据会被同时写入两块盘中,同时,可用容量为单块硬盘的容量。做完RAID1需要最少两块盘,一块存储原始数据,另一块存储数据的镜像,做完RAID1后可用容量为一块盘的容量。
2024-03-20 17:50:39
628
1
原创 启动/关闭 oracle数据库
开启事务 BEGIN TRANSACTION;Oracle数据库有四种状态:SHUTDOWN、NOMOUNT、MOUNT、OPEN.在状态mount下,无法查看表,数据库open状态可以查看表。3.银行存钱需要确认,确认即commit;实例处于mount状态,控制文件、数据文件已加载可查询。1.创建一个连接就是一个会话。2.一个会话可以有很多个事务。该状态查询不到控制文件和数据文件。
2023-11-15 20:10:19
332
原创 Swingbench 压测
百度网盘下载:链接:https://pan.baidu.com/s/1obN59g9fAWs92wZ6aUAiiQ?pwd=lfru提取码:lfru--来自百度网盘超级会员V1的分享。
2023-11-14 19:43:11
264
1
原创 HammerDB
HammerDB是针对Oracle,Microsoft SQL Server,IBM DB2,TimesTen,MySQL,MariaDB,PostgreSQL,Postgres Plus Advanced Server等数据以及Greenplum,Redis,Amazon Aurora和Redshift以及Hadoop上的传统 SQL的开源数据库负载测试和基准测试工具。
2023-11-14 18:34:00
219
1
原创 Linux系统调优常见命令
1、/proc/sys/vm/swappiness文件:配置何时使用swap分区# swappiness文件可以设置范围0-100,当设置不同值时,SWAP策略的差异性就会出现swappiness值SWAP策略这会导致linux系统几乎禁用SWAP,除非出现out of Memory 的情况这是除禁止SWAP之外的最保守的sWAP策略通常在内存空间非常充足时,为了提高整体性能,会将值更改为10,以便有效降低SwAP使用频次默认值,属于中庸策略。
2023-11-10 20:54:39
67
1
原创 Oracle(1) Oracle Architectural Components oracle相关体系结构
整体分为两部分:Instance(实例)和Database(数据库)一个Instance只能访问一个Database,一个Database可以访问多个Instance由Memory structures(内存)和Background process structures(进程)组成,主要包括:(1)SGA:SystemGlobal Area是OracleInstance的基本组成部分,在实例启动时分配;系统全局域SGA主要由三部分构成:共享池、数据缓冲区、日志缓冲区。
2023-11-06 16:26:59
82
原创 Linux常见服务
1) crond是Linux中一个可以定时进行任务调度的后台程序。2) 任务调度是指系统在某个时间执行的特定的命令或程序。3) 任务调度分类 :系统工作--有些重要的工作必须周而复始地执行。如病毒扫面等。个别用户工作--个别用户可能希望执行某些程序。编写脚本shell来使crond进行定时调 用,比如mysql。数据库的备份;使crond定时调用简单任务,比如一条指令。NFS (Network File System)即网络文件系统:它允许网络中的计算机之间通过TCP/IP网络共享资源。
2023-11-02 20:19:48
513
原创 将数据文件,控制文件,日志文件分别放在不同的目录下,且数据库正常启动。
当数据库处于归档模式时,系统会将日志文件归档并保存到指定的位置,以便在数据库发生故障时进行恢复。log_archive_dest_1参数就是用来指定归档日志的存放位置。在Oracle数据库中,log_archive_dest_1是一个重要的参数,它用来定义归档日志的存放位置。归档日志是数据库在运行时生成的日志文件,记录了数据库的修改操作。Oracle数据库中的log_archive_dest_1参数详解。要查看Oracle数据库的数据文件、控制文件和日志文件的位置。查看可见控制文件的路径已经自动修改。
2023-10-30 22:28:41
198
1
原创 设置数据库默认为spfle启动,并且数据库SGA大小为2G,PGA大小为200M
1、pfile和spfileOracle中的参数文件是一个包含一系列参数以及参数对应值的操作系统文件。它们是在数据库实例启动时候加载的,决定了数据库的物理结构、内存、数据库的限制及系统大量的默认值、数据库的各种物理属性、指定数据库控制文件名和路径等信息,是进行数据库设计和性能调优的重要文件。
2023-10-28 20:11:24
208
1
原创 Redhat7.9创建一块5g的新硬盘,创建lv并挂载,设置永久挂载,并将其扩容到10g。
/扩展已有卷的容量(下面的参数值为free PE /Site的值)//将初始化过的分区加入到虚拟卷组zhr-vg。//对磁盘设备进行Ext4格式化处理。// 查看VG卷组的容量,如下图所示。//在虚拟机中新加一块5g的硬盘。每次重启虚拟机后,将会自动挂载!//扩容之前的磁盘到10g。// 显示VG卷组的信息。
2023-10-26 16:02:51
1186
原创 swingbench 中connect string连接问题
这里我的服务名可能有点问题,也可以用:alter system set service_name=‘orcl’;将其修改为“orcl”。这里的Connect String应该是你的ip+服务名。service_names就是你需要的服务名。ip可以用ifconfig查找。将其放在一块就可以链接成功!
2023-10-20 21:37:33
178
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人